A composer and music historian with Turkish and French roots, contributed significantly to film scores and classical music. Worked on more than 150 films in France, producing memorable melodies and innovative compositions that enhanced cinematic storytelling. Additionally, engaged in music education and scholarly research, compiling a rich history of music that influenced future generations. Recognized for the fusion of classical music elements into contemporary compositions, paving the way for new musical explorations.
